CVE-2022-24917 is a reflected Cross-Site Scripting (XSS) vulnerability affecting Zabbix frontend, Debian Linux, and Fedora. An authenticated attacker can craft a malicious link containing JavaScript, which, if clicked by a victim, could execute arbitrary code within their browser. Exploitation requires knowledge of the victim's CSRF token, making it difficult to achieve. The vulnerability has a CVSS score of 4.4 (Medium) due to its high attack complexity and low impact on confidentiality and integrity. There is no evidence of active exploitation, public exploit code, or significant community discussion surrounding this CVE.
